Part 1: Navigating the Product Ecosystem and Technical Resources
The Sonix MCU Official Website is meticulously organized to cater to both new visitors and seasoned experts. The primary landing sections typically include Products, Development Tools, Support, and Downloads.
The product section is categorically segmented, often by core architecture (e.g., 8-bit SN8P Series, 32-bit SN32F Series), application focus (Touch MCUs, Voice Prompt MCUs, Motor Control MCUs), or by key features. Each product series has its dedicated page containing a high-level overview, key features, target applications, and most importantly, links to the definitive technical documentation: datasheets, reference manuals, and application notes. These documents are indispensable for schematic design, programming, and debugging.

Beyond basic specs, the website frequently houses a comprehensive Application Notes library. These are practical guides addressing common design challenges such as implementing low-power modes, optimizing touch sensing algorithms, or managing motor control peripherals. For engineers, these notes are often as valuable as the datasheet itself, providing proven implementation strategies that can save weeks of development time. Furthermore, detailed selection guides and comparison tables are available to help users quickly filter MCUs based on parameters like flash size, RAM, GPIO count, package type, and integrated peripherals (ADCs, Timers, Communication interfaces like UART, I2C, SPI).
Part 2: Development Tools, Software Suites, and Firmware
An MCU is only as good as the tools that program it. The Sonix website dedicates significant resources to its software and hardware development ecosystem.
The central component is the integrated development environment (IDE) and compiler, which is often available for free download. Sonix typically provides its own user-friendly IDE that supports project management, code editing, simulation, and in-circuit debugging. The website provides clear installation guides and version histories for this software.
For hardware, the site details official evaluation boards (EVBs) and development kits. These kits are crucial for prototyping and testing the capabilities of an MCU in a real hardware environment. Product pages for these kits include user manuals, schematic files (often in PDF format), and example code projects. The availability of sample code and firmware libraries is a major highlight. These libraries abstract complex register-level operations into manageable API calls for functions like GPIO control, ADC sampling, or UART communication, dramatically reducing initial coding effort and minimizing potential errors.
Importantly, for programming mass-produced chips, the website provides information on official programmers and debuggers (e.g., Writer Pro devices), including their driver software and user guides. Ensuring compatibility between your chosen MCU and the programming hardware is essential, and this information is reliably sourced only from the official site.
